1. The Origins of the Rubik’s Cube
The Rubik’s Cube was invented in 1974 by Hungarian architect Ernő Rubik. Initially called the “Magic Cube,” it was meant to be a teaching tool for understanding three-dimensional geometry. However, it became a global phenomenon, with millions sold worldwide. What makes this cube so fascinating is not just its vibrant colors but also the cognitive challenge it presents. Today, it remains one of the best-selling puzzles of all time, demonstrating its broad appeal across generations.
In the 1980s, the cube exploded in popularity, largely due to a surge of interest in puzzle-solving. Competitions began popping up across the globe, leading to the establishment of official Rubik’s Cube championships. Fast forward to today, the cube is not only a staple in pop culture but also a tool for enhancing problem-solving skills and cognitive function.
2. Understanding the Cube’s Structure
Before diving into solving techniques, it’s essential to understand the cube’s mechanics. The traditional Rubik’s Cube consists of six faces, each made up of nine stickers. Each face can turn independently, allowing for numerous permutations. There are 43 quintillion possible configurations, which makes solving it a challenge even for experienced puzzlers.
The cube has a core that holds all the pieces together, allowing smaller pieces—called edge and corner pieces—to rotate. Knowing this structure is crucial because it allows you to visualize movements and predict outcomes while you work through the solving process. It’s like learning the anatomy of a complex machine before you attempt to fix it.
3. The Beginner’s Method: Layer by Layer
For those just starting, the layer-by-layer method is one of the simplest and most popular techniques. This approach breaks the solving process down into three main stages: solving the first layer, the middle layer, and then the last layer. Each layer is tackled sequentially, which simplifies the overall task.
Start with the first layer by creating a cross on one face, ensuring that the edge pieces’ colors match the center pieces of the adjacent faces. Next, position the corner pieces to complete the first layer. Once the first layer is complete, move on to the middle layer by positioning the edge pieces correctly. Last but not least, the final layer requires specific algorithms to orient and position the remaining pieces correctly. By mastering each layer, you develop a strong foundation that can lead to more advanced techniques.

9. Advanced Techniques: Learning from the Pros
Once you’ve grasped the fundamentals, exploring advanced techniques can dramatically enhance your solving speed and efficiency. For example, the Roux method is a popular alternative to CFOP among speedcubers, focusing on building blocks rather than layers. It includes fewer moves overall and can be faster for those who master it. Many top speedcubers also rely on the ZZ method, which emphasizes edge orientation early in the solving process to streamline the last layer.
These methods often require a solid understanding of algorithms and intensive practice, but adopting them can be transformative. A well-rounded cuber might apply elements from various methods, customizing their approach to suit their style and preferences. If you aim to compete, familiarizing yourself with these advanced techniques can make a significant difference in your performance.
10. Statistics and Records in Speedcubing
The world of speedcubing is filled with impressive statistics and records that can motivate cubers to improve their skills. As of 2023, the world record for the fastest solve of a 3×3 Rubik’s Cube is held by Yusheng Du, with an astonishing time of just 3.47 seconds. This record highlights the peak of human capability and the dedication of speedcubers worldwide. (See: Harvard University resources on cognitive skills.)
In addition to individual records, competitions like the World Cube Association (WCA) organize events globally, showcasing the talents of thousands of participants. The events not only include traditional cubes but also a variety of other puzzles, such as 2×2, 4×4, and even blindfolded categories. Collectively, these events contribute to a thriving community where enthusiasts can share techniques, learn from one another, and celebrate achievements.
The statistics surrounding average solves can also be enlightening. Top competitors often achieve average solve times under 6 seconds, while casual cubers might take anywhere from 30 seconds to several minutes. Understanding where you fit within this spectrum can help set realistic goals and motivate you to improve.

14. How to Choose Your First Cube
If you’re new to the Rubik’s Cube, selecting your first cube can significantly impact your learning experience. The standard 3×3 cube is a great starting point, but there are many options available. Consider looking for a cube that is specifically designed for beginners, which typically features smoother turning and better corner cutting. Some popular beginner brands include MoYu and Gan, which offer cubes that are both affordable and user-friendly.
Pay attention to the cube’s tension and magnet strength as well. A cube with adjustable tension allows you to customize the feel according to your preference, making it easier to learn and solve. Additionally, magnetic cubes can help stabilize the layers during turns, which is beneficial for both beginners and advanced cubers alike.
